The Data Entry Specialist supports Novir’s onsite vaccination clinic operations by ensuring accurate vaccine eligibility verification and timely completion of post-clinic documentation. This role works primarily within state immunization registries and customer electronic medical record (EMR) systems to maintain complete and accurate resident vaccination records.
This is a seasonal position, with the majority of work performed during Monday-Friday afternoon/evening shifts. Dependability, accuracy, and the ability to work independently are essential to success in this role.

What You'll Do:
- Access state immunization registries to review resident vaccination histories.
- Determine resident eligibility for vaccines being offered at scheduled clinics.
- Review and reconcile immunization information across systems.
- Accurately document vaccine eligibility and related information within Novir's TRACK system.
- Identify discrepancies or incomplete records and escalate issues appropriately.
- Utilize Novir's post-clinic reports to document vaccines administered in the appropriate state immunization registry.
- Complete documentation accurately and within required timelines.
- Review submitted records for accuracy and completeness.
- Address rejected, incomplete, or discrepant records as appropriate.
- Complete post-clinic documentation in customer EMR systems.
- Document resident vaccine administrations, consents, and refusals according to customer requirements.
- Ensure documentation is entered under the correct resident and accurately reflects the services provided.
- Complete documentation within established Novir and customer timelines.
- Communicate EMR access issues or documentation barriers promptly.

Required Experience & Technical Knowledge:
- Prior experience with electronic medical records, immunization registries, healthcare data entry, or a related administrative/clinical support function preferred.
- Working knowledge and experience with one or more of the following state immunization registries:
- WIR - Wisconsin Immunization Registry
- NCIR - North Carolina Immunization Registry
- SHOTS - Florida Immunization Information System
- CIIS - Colorado Immunization Information System
- Experience with customer EMR platforms preferred, including:
- PointClickCare (PCC)
- ECP
- Matrix
- ElderMark
- Strong computer skills and ability to navigate multiple software platforms.
- Ability to learn and follow customer-specific documentation requirements.
